#4ed598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4ed598 is composed of 30.6% red, 83.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 63.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 28.6%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 152.9 degrees, a saturation of 61.6% and a lightness of 57.1%. #4ed598 color hex could be obtained by blending #9cffff with #00ab31.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

● #4ed598 color description : Moderate cyan - lime green.
#4ed598 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4ed598 has RGB values of R:78, G:213,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0, Y:0.29,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 5166488.
